Where this album fits
- Career context
- Released in November 1972, 'Il mio canto libero' was Battisti's fourth album and solidified his status as a leading figure in Italian pop music. This album followed the commercial success of 'Amore e non amore', showcasing his evolution toward more complex arrangements and deeper lyrical themes during a period when he was gaining significant recognition.
